Chandigarh: Marking four years of the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) government under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Singh Mann, the party on Friday continued its statewide outreach campaign “Shandaar 4 Saal, Bhagwant Mann de Naal”, with the second day of the ‘Samvad’ initiative witnessing widespread participation across Punjab, as Ministers and MLAs engaged directly with citizens to present the government’s report card and gather public feedback.

Cabinet Ministers Barinder Kumar Goyal, Harbhajan Singh ETO, and Lal Chand Kataruchak directly engaged with people in their respective constituencies, holding nukkad meetings and public interactions to highlight the achievements of the Bhagwant Mann Government over the past four years.

In Lehra, Minister Barinder Kumar Goyal stated, “The Bhagwant Mann Government has focused on delivering real change at the grassroots level, ensuring that benefits reach every household.”

In another outreach, Minister Harbhajan Singh ETO said, “The government’s key achievements include improvements in education, healthcare, electricity, employment, infrastructure, and law and order.”

Minister Lal Chand Kataruchak added, “This campaign is not just about highlighting achievements, but also about strengthening direct communication with citizens and understanding their aspirations, ensuring that governance remains responsive, transparent, and accountable.”

As part of the campaign, AAP MLAs and leaders reached multiple villages and urban wards including Barnala, Rajrana (Sardulgarh), Momiyan (Shutrana), Bahon Yatari (Bathinda Rural), and Gidder (Bhucho Mandi), where they held interactive meetings with residents. Similar outreach programmes were conducted in Bhai Bakhtaur, Ghuman Kalan, Mansa, Kasam Bhatti (Jaitu), and Ludhiana East.

On the second day of the campaign, meetings were also organized in Dheema Wali (Kotkapura), Samana, Khiali (Mehal Kalan), and several areas of Balluana, where people gathered in large numbers and extended overwhelming support.

Further expanding the reach of the campaign, interactions were held in Bugra (Maur Mandi), Patiala Urban, Bhucho Mandi, Jalandhar Cantt, Talwandi Sabo, and Sundarchakk (Bhoa), where citizens appreciated the government’s efforts and expressed gratitude for improved public services and welfare initiatives.
